November 11-17 is American Education Week. Teachers of today have so many more challenges to deal with in educating students than they did just two decades ago: violence, attention deficit syndrome, multi-language students, state standards, the Information Age, 21st Century literacy and skills, individualizing instruction, performance-based evaluation, the trend toward learning without textbooks, etc.
Fortunately, technology is now evolving that can help teachers to cope with many of these problems, IF they get quality professional development combined with products that address many of these challenges.
